The Empire State Building is one of the better teen activities in New York City. It is one of the more popular and famous New York City landmarks. The teens will love the view from the top of this magnificent structure. You can expect to stand in the line to get in for a few hours to see these teen activities in New York City. The elevators take a long time to go to the eightieth floor and back. Once you reach that floor, you will take another elevator higher. You can expect this teen activity in New York City to be visited by many people. When you finally make it up to the observation deck, you may not have a place to stand. It takes another couple hours to go back down again. It takes quite awhile but its worth it.
